Definir a arquitetura de software envolve implantar uma solução estruturada que atenda ao maior número possível dos requisitos técnicos e operacion...
Definir a arquitetura de software envolve implantar uma solução estruturada que atenda ao maior número possível dos requisitos técnicos e operacionais e que aperfeiçoe os atributos de qualidade (como desempenho, segurança e capacidade de gerenciamento). Além disso, essas decisões devem considerar restrições de projetos, como o custo e tempo, e elementos de contexto, como política e clima organizacional. Considerando o exposto, o que significam as decisões?
a) São as escolhas que o desenvolvedor faz para atender aos requisitos técnicos e operacionais do software. b) São as escolhas que o desenvolvedor faz para atender aos requisitos técnicos e operacionais do software, considerando restrições de projetos e elementos de contexto. c) São as escolhas que o desenvolvedor faz para atender aos requisitos técnicos e operacionais do software, considerando apenas restrições de projetos.
Considerando o exposto, as decisões na definição da arquitetura de software são as escolhas que o desenvolvedor faz para atender aos requisitos técnicos e operacionais do software, considerando restrições de projetos e elementos de contexto. Portanto, a alternativa correta é a letra b).
0
0
Faça como milhares de estudantes: teste grátis o Passei Direto
Compartilhar